Months after Atlassian acquired Opsgenie, Jay Simons, Atlassian's president, explained why the company is spending $166 million to buy AgileCraft.

Atlassian announced on Monday that it will acquire the Texas-based startup AgileCraft for $166 million.

AgileCraft, which was founded in 2013, helps companies with building and managing their projects, essentially helping them create a"master plan." According to PitchBook, AgileCraft raised $10 million after raising its Series B round in 2015. This deal, which comprises approximately $154 million in cash and the remainder in Atlassian restricted shares, is expected to close in early April.

"Customers that we've spoken to are really happy about the capability for businesses for agile planning at scale," Jay Simons, president, told Business Insider."We've got lots of customers who don't have this capability. My hope is they see the acquisition announcement and join the happy family of customers who are using AgileCraft."
